28th Annual Lake Mingo Trail Run   Est. 1999

Saturday, June 13 , 2026 @ 9:00 a.m.

From the RD: This race is special and each year we mix it up by changing directions. On Odd years the course is clockwise and On Even years the course is counterclockwise. So make sure you train accordingly.

Grand Slam Event #3: An awesome award will be presented to everyone who finishes these great Kennekuk Events in 2025.  Siberian Express, Mountain Goat, Lake Mingo Trail Run, and Wild Wild Wilderness.  Awards will be presented at the Wild Wild Wilderness race.

Location: Kennekuk Cove County Park. Take I-74 to exit 210 and follow the signs to the park. Address is: 22296-A Henning Road Danville, IL 61834

Course Mingo Trail: The course is 90% trail with 7% grassland and 3% rock & asphalt.  There are numerous hills, 9 bridges and marshlands.  This 7.1 mile course goes around Lake Mingo and you go across the earth dam.  It is deep woods and you may see deer, wild turkeys, geese, wood ducks, snakes and giant blue Heron.   Depending on the weather, you may get wet and muddy. Or you might be hot as heck and needing to visit that hydration station halfway around the lake. If a storm washes out one of the bridges... there may be a creek crossing. How fun would that be?

Aid Stations: There is one aid station halfway through the course. The hydration station will have water, various beverages and limited snacks.

Race Day Registration: Available from 8:00 to 8:45 and the cost is $45. Cash or checks may be made payable to KRR.  Race day registration does not include the shirt. T-shirt Cutoff Date:  TBD– You must register online by this date to order a shirt/sweatshirt.  There may be a small selection of shirts available for purchase at a cost of $20. Limited shirts may be available at the after party but there are no guarantees.

Packet Pickup: Packet will include your shirt, bib and pins and can be picked up on race day from 8:00 to 8:45

Time Limit: No time limit

Finisher Medals: will be presented to the first 150 runners as you cross the finish line.

Age Group Awards: TBD

Regulations: No bandits, radios, strollers, or dogs allowed.  No shirts or awards will be mailed.  No refunds or bib transfers. You must be present to win any drawings at the post race party.

Special Thanks: Please join us in thanking the Kennekuk County Park Staff, all of our dedicated volunteers, and loyal sponsors.

Post Race Party: Immediately following the race, the party will be at the Hideaway Shelter.  Kennekuk will have pulled pork and pulled chicken with chips and old style keg beer

Camping: Nearby Kickapoo State Park has two major campgrounds for tent and trailer camping with 184 sites. About half of the sites have electrical hookups.   Two shower buildings and a sanitary dump station are available.  A limited number of walk in sites are available for primitive campers, but several campsites can be reserved by writing the site or by applying in person.  For more information go to: https://dnr.illinois.gov/parks/park.kickapoo.html or call 217-442-4915
